原文:性能測試三十九:Jprofiler分析CPU過高和響應時間長的問題

使用Jprofiler監控分析案例 一 cpu負載過高:http: localhost: PerfTeach CpuTopServlet id cpu消耗高的可能原因 使用了復雜的算法,比如加密 解密 壓縮 解壓 序列化等操作 代碼bug,比如死循環 dstat監控起來,先看一下資源是否正常,用 個並發跑 秒 CPU: TPS才幾百,肯定就有問題 TOP:JAVA占的CPU最多 查看進程,是to ...

2019-01-27 00:05 0 2645 推薦指數:

查看詳情

使用jprofiler定位響應時間長問題

使用jprofiler的方法耗時統計功能,可以統計出每個方法的耗時 1、點擊“CPU views”- “Method Statistics” 2、點擊監控按鈕,開始監控進程的方法耗時 3、等待30s(自己掌握,時間太短分析樣本太少),點擊停止監控按鈕 ...

Wed Nov 24 01:59:00 CST 2021 0 801
性能測試案例:數據庫cpu高導致響應時間長

前幾天在用jmeter做性能測試的時候,遇到一個響應時間長性能問題,簡單總結一下,分享給大家,希望能給大家在性能測試過程中類似問題提供一個性能問題分析定位的思路。 現象如下圖,響應時間很長,達到了18秒左右,tps也只有20 監控: 根據經驗,直奔oracle數據庫服務器 ...

Wed Apr 01 07:59:00 CST 2020 0 628
性能測試--響應時間

響應時間過程分析: 我們需要對這個過程進行分解,才能得到你真正想要的響應時間。我把整個過程分三個部分:呈現時間,數據傳輸時間和系統處理時間。 呈現時間 其實主要說的瀏覽器對接收到數據的一個處理展示的過程。幾年前大家都在用IE,如果頁面顯示比較慢,我們肯定不會怪罪IE,只會怪罪電信運營商的網速 ...

Thu Jul 04 22:47:00 CST 2019 0 641
性能測試知多少---響應時間

  在上一節中,我們講到吞吐量,做為一個用戶你可以對吞吐量毫不關心,但響應時間卻是用戶感受系統性能的主要體現。   從用戶角度來說,軟件性能就是軟件對用戶操作的響應時間。說得更明確一點,對用戶來說,當用戶單擊一個按鈕,發出一條指令或在web頁面上單擊一個鏈接,從用戶單擊開始到應用系統把本次 ...

Sun Jul 01 23:27:00 CST 2012 7 64585
性能測試之-響應時間

響應時間=網絡傳輸時間(請求)+服務器處理時間(一層或是多層)+網絡傳輸時間響應)+頁面前段解析時間 響應時間=呈現時間+網絡傳輸時間+服務器端響應時間+應用延時時間 呈現時間   其實主要說的瀏覽器對接收到數據的一個處理展示的過程。幾年前大家都在用IE,如果頁面顯示比較慢 ...

Wed Jun 14 18:19:00 CST 2017 0 9725
性能測試 | 吞吐量響應時間CPU利用率之間的關系

文章轉自:原創: 楊建旭 https://mp.weixin.qq.com/s/Y2pE6wDTJ0bma0DXOBTC0g 在實際的生產運行、測試過程中,一般都會關注吞吐量、響應時間CPU利用率,在開發和測試階段,我們不但需要關注 ...

Sat Dec 28 01:28:00 CST 2019 0 715
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M